Why is it important?  About 93% of the projected adult population of 2015 have Aadhaar numbers. The first card was issued in September 2010, which makes it the fastest jump from zero to billion in digital history. The challenge ahead is to use Aadhaar to provide government services, such as subsidies, more efficiently.

Yes, you can open a bank account without an Aadhaar card by visiting the branch. However, opening a bank account without an Aadhaar takes time. You must provide Original PAN card along with an Officially Valid Document (OVD) instead of an Aadhaar card if you wish to open a bank account without Aadhaar.

Yes, you can open a bank account without Aadhaar linked mobile number by visiting the branch. However, to avail yourself of various government benefits, you may need to link your Aadhaar to your mobile number.

Your Aadhaar card serves as a single, comprehensive identification document for opening a savings account online. With its 12-digit unique number, this card eliminates the need for multiple identity and address proofs. Through the Aadhaar-based e-KYC, the bank can swiftly authenticate customer details electronically, reducing paperwork and processing time.

This streamlined process enhances convenience for customers, enabling a faster account opening process while maintaining stringent security measures. Your Aadhaar card significantly expedites the KYC verification process, making the savings account opening process efficient and hassle-free.

The process of opening a savings account with Aadhaar is highly secure. Aadhaar authentication adds an extra layer of security through an OTP authentication. This ensures that only the rightful owner can access and use their Aadhaar details for opening their account. Additionally, stringent data protection measures are in place to safeguard personal information. With these security features, you can stay assured that your identity and financial data are protected throughout the account opening process.

Historically, applications using biometrics have been initiated by authorities for military access control and criminal or civil identification under a tightly regulated legal and technical framework.

Today Automated Biometric Identification Systems (ABIS) can create and store biometric information that matches biometric templates for the face (using the so-called mugshot systems), finger, and iris.

Live face recognition - the ability to perform face identification in a crowd in real-time or post-event - is also gaining interest for public security - in cities, airports, borders, or other sensitives such as stadiums or places of worship.

The electronic passport (e-passport) is a familiar biometric travel document. The second generation of such documents, also known as biometric passports, includes two fingerprints stored and a passport photo.

That means over 1.2 billion travelers have a standardized digital portrait in a secure document. It's a windfall for automatic border control systems (aka e-gates) and self-service kiosks.

The U.S. Department of Homeland Security's Customs and Border Protection (CBP) declared that more than 43.7m individuals had been scanned at border crossings, outbound cruise ships, and elsewhere so far. This process helped stop 252 people from attempting to use another person's passport to cross the border. (V.B., 6 February 2020.)

AFIS databases (Automated Fingerprint Identification System), often linked to a civil register database, ensure citizens' identity and uniqueness to the rest of the population in a reliable, fast, and automated way.

India's Aadhaar project is emblematic of biometric registration. It is the world's most extensive biometric identification system and the cornerstone of reliable identification and authentication in India.

The Aadhaar number is a 12-digit unique identity number issued to all Indian residents. This number is based on their biographic and biometric data (a photograph, ten fingerprints, and two iris scans).

The technical challenges of automated recognition of individuals based on their biological and behavioral characteristics are inherent in transforming analog (facial image, fingerprint, voice pattern) to digital information (patterns, minutiae) that can then be processed, compared and matched with effective algorithms.

Therefore, biometric checks must be carried out on a trusted secure device, which means the alternatives are to have a centralized and supervised server, a trusted biometric device, or a personal security component.

Numerous national identity cards (Portugal, Ecuador, South Africa, Mongolia, Algeria, etc.) now incorporate digital security features based on the "Match-on-Card" fingerprint matching algorithm.

Unlike conventional biometric processes, the "Match-on-Card" algorithm allows fingerprints to be matched locally with a reference frame thanks to a microprocessor built into the biometric I.D. card without connecting to a central biometric database (1:1 matching).

Identification answers the question, "Who are you?". In this case, the person is identified as one, among others (1: N matching). The person's data to be identified are compared with those stored in the same or possibly other linked databases.
